How to prepare for a job interview at Brakes
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, dive deep into Brakes and their offerings. Familiarise yourself with their products, services, and recent news in the foodservice industry. This will not only show your genuine interest but also help you tailor your answers to align with their goals.
✨Showcase Your Sales Skills
Prepare specific examples from your past experiences that highlight your ability to hunt for new business opportunities and close deals.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and demonstrate how you've successfully met targets in previous roles.
✨Connect with the Culture
Brakes values diversity and wants candidates who can help shape their culture. Be ready to discuss how your unique background and experiences can contribute to their inclusive workplace. Share personal anecdotes that reflect your adaptability and teamwork.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the role, team dynamics, and company growth plans. This shows your enthusiasm and helps you gauge if Brakes is the right fit for you. Consider asking about their approach to market trends or how they support new Business Development Managers in achieving success.
